I'm running 1.81 with the Gravity Crash exploit. I've got a few emulators working thus far (daedalus works great, no sound though...) NES works perfectly, Gameboy (Masterboy to be exact) runs just as well as on my PSP. I have yet to get a SNES emulator to actually work. They either crash when trying to load my ROM list, or the best one I had one of the versions of Euphoria would load the rom, but then started to load the default settings (speedhacks to be exact) and would hang there (I expect the speed hacks, trying to overclock the virtual PSP CPU in the PSP emulator on the Vita is likely to cause such problems, lol). Any ideas on what I can do to fix these issues? What Emulators have you guys found that work the best?

i had this same problem, too many roms will make that happen...what i did to fix it was make individual folders with about 50-100 roms in each folder like this:

A-D
E-G
H-K
L-N
and so on...

i have about 900 roms total in my snes emulator and havent had any problems since i separated them...i also had to do this with all my other emu's when the same problems occurred, but it was always the same fix...id say i have about 5000+ roms total over 5 different emu's on my Vita...if i didnt have the same thing on my GO, i probably wouldnt update to 2.0, cuz its just fun saying i have that many games on one handheld console (even though i wont EVER get around to playing all of them). xD
